New Hybrid Car Is The Way Of The Future





By new hybrid car we refer to any vehicle that relies on two separate power sources for propulsion. Among the power sources for a new hybrid car there are gasoline or diesel fuel, on-board or out-board rechargeable energy storage systems (RESS), hydrogen, wind, compressed or liquid natural gas, solar, coal, wood or other solid combustibles, etc. The very concept of new hybrid car designates electric vehicles that adapt the usage of an internal combustion engine to that of the electrical batteries.

A new hybrid car presents a number of advantages from the environmental perspective and there are two sides to consider here. First, there is the aspect of fuel economy, and secondly, the benefit for the environment and, implicitly, for humankind is undeniable in the fight to reduce pollution. There is a triple combination of factors that make the design of a new hybrid car so appropriate for our times: first there is the combination gas-electricity, secondly, the battery comes with a high storage capacity, and thirdly, the kinetic energy wasted by braking is recuperated and reused.
